Crash on the A40 - 13 Jul 1980
Accident reference 198001GDFGC19
Accident summary
On Sunday 13 July 1980 at 05:30 a slight collision occurred near A40 involving 1 vehicle and 1 casualty (1 slight) Weather at the time was recorded as raining no high winds. Road surface conditions were wet or damp. Lighting was described as daylight.
